One might well ask …what is an air bearing?
An air bearing is a non-contact, frictionless bearing system that uses a thin layer of pressurized gas (mainly air) that works as a lubricant, creating a gas film between the surface and the substrate.
Air is released under pressure inside the part and, using nozzles and micro-grooves or porous material, it is spread among the surface and the substrate.
This slight layer of air gap which is created among them, measures just a few thousandths of a millimeter thick, and it acts as the lubricant with a very low friction coefficient.
The result is a motion without contact which implies no sip-stick phenomenon, no friction, no maintenance, ultra-precision, and clean motion with higher stiffness.

Air bearings, compared to sliding and rolling bearings, provide countless and important advantages in many applications, to name some:
- Maximum smooth motion, no stick-slip, no wear of parts
- Maximum reliability, No maintenance
- Superior positioning precision
- Reliable precision results over time, thanks to absence of wear
- Low environment impact: air bearings do not use oil or grease lubricants, so they do not pollute. First choice in clean room applications
- Low noise pollution thanks to no contact between parts and thus no friction
- Maximum reliability with high temperature and radioactive sources
